Hi Stacey,One of the best exercises for losing weight at any time is brisk walking. Ditch the heels, put on some trainers get baby into the buggy or pram and go for it girl! you can do it and just getting out will help to cheer you up. Chuck those chocs and settle for fruit, it is cheaper than chocs and sooo... good for you yet helps with the need for sweetness. You don't need to go to the gym either. Get a Pilates ball (also called a Fitball) got mine from Tesco and a book called The Fitball Workout by Jan Endacott (published by Hamlyn) . This works a treat and the exercises are really fun to do.
I have lost just over a stone in a month. measure all your portions, I weigh mine then find things like yoghurt pots and measuring cups that hold just the right amount, it makes it all so much easier.
The Special K diet really does work and you won't feel hungry. I work shifts so I find it best to have my Special K morning and evening and my meal at midday. I also have a good portion of fresh fruit salad every day. My main meal is often something with a salad, or stir fry. My non-stick frying pan is my life saver as I can cook anything in it with no fat. I even make toasted sandwiches in it! Goodluck and I hope things go eally well for you.
